Air Fryer Garlic Parmesan Corn Recipe
Description
The recipe starts by husking sweet corn ears and trimming if needed to fit the air fryer. The corn is coated evenly with softened butter and sprinkled with salt, black pepper, and minced garlic cloves or garlic powder. It is cooked at 400°F for 10 minutes, flipped halfway through, to achieve tender kernels with light browning.
Once cooked, the hot corn ears are rolled in freshly grated Parmesan cheese, which clings to the butter surface adding a savory and nutty flavor. Fresh parsley or chives are sprinkled on top to add color and a fresh herbal note. The corn is juicy with a buttery, garlicky, and cheesy taste and a slightly crisp exterior from air frying.
Frozen corn can be used but requires longer cooking. Avoid overcrowding the basket to ensure even cooking and airflow. The recipe provides a flavorful alternative to boiled or grilled corn side dishes but with less mess and quicker cleanup.
Ingredients
- 4 ears sweet corn
- 2 tablespoon butter softened, unsalted
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 4 cloves garlic
- ¼ cup Parmesan Cheese grated
- parsley fresh
Instructions
- Husk the corn and cut it if needed to fit in the air fryer basket.
- Spread the butter over the corn kernels.
- Sprinkle the sweet corn with the salt, pepper, and minced garlic.
- Put the corn in the air fry basket and cook at 400 degrees F for 10 minutes. Flip it once halfway through the cooking time.
- Put the grated Parmesan on a plate and roll the corn ears in the cheese.
- Serve with parsley or chives.
Notes
- Frozen corn can be used; increase cooking time by a few minutes but fresh corn yields best flavor.
- Garlic powder may substitute fresh garlic cloves if preferred.
- Avoid overcrowding the air fryer basket to ensure even cooking and browning.
